United States Postal Service Kicks off ‘Toy Story 3′ Priority Mail Campaign
In one of the more interesting joint promotions for the new Disney/Pixar film, the United States Postal Service (USPS) has enlisted Sheriff Woody and the gang to help promote its priority mail service. The Priority Mail website was the first element in the campaign, receiving a visit from the popular toons.
Kicking off last week, Post Office retail locations across the country have begun displaying posters as well as other Toy Story-themed promotional materials. The Post Offices are also selling several birthday cards from Sunrise Greetings featuring many of the characters from the trilogy as well as padded envelopes in multiple sizes.
Also in apparent light rotation is this television advertisement featuring the Toy Story characters promoting the service. In the spot, Hamm takes up the role of letter carrier, no doubt a tip of the postal hat to John Ratzenberger’s Cliff Clavin character on Cheers, who was also a letter carrier for the USPS.

Toy Story Characters to Promote USPS Priority Mail Service
The Walt Disney Company and the United States Postal Service have announced that they will begin running a television commercial in mid-May featuring characters from the upcoming Disney/Pixar release of Toy Story 3. The advertising spot will promote the USPS’ priority mail service.
